The global anticoagulants market size was estimated at USD 31.04 billion in 2023 and it is projected to surpass around USD 75.53 billion by 2033, growing at a registered CAGR of 9.3% during the forecast period 2024 to 2033. Anticoagulants are commonly known as blood thinners which are basically chemical substances that prevent coagulation of blood. The medicines that help in preventing the blood clots it is administered for people which are at a high risk of getting there close to reduce the chances of developing some other conditions that could be harmful and false heart attacks or strokes. In order to stop bleeding from the wounds the blood clot is a seal which is created by the blood. Blood clots could potentially block a blood vessel and disrupt the blood flow around the body.

The U.S. anticoagulants market size was estimated at USD 12.66 billion in 2023 and is predicted to be worth around USD 32.13 billion by 2033, at a CAGR of 9.8% from 2024 to 2033.
North American region has generated the largest revenue in the recent years and it is anticipated to dominate the global market in the forecast. North America anticoagulants market size was valued at USD 18.05 billion in 2023. Due to the increasing prevalence of cardiovascular diseases and the treatment which is required coupled together is driving the market in this region. Anticoagulants Markets in the Europe are expected to grow significantly in the years to come, as a result of increasing prevalence of cardiovascular disease, which in turn is increasing the adoption rates of the medications like blood thinning. For instance, according to the European Cardiovascular Disease Statistics, cardiovascular disease registers for more than 45% of all the deaths in Europe. Germany, UK, and France are predicted to contribute to the robust growth of the markets in the Europe.
Markets in the Latin America and the Middle East & Africa (LAMEA) are projected to attain steady growth. This growth is in account of growing propensity of cardiac disorders like heart attacks. An increasing consumption of developed anticoagulant drugs is another factor boosting the growth of this market in the LAMEA region.

With respect to drug class, the market is classified into NOACs, heparin & LMWH, vitamin K antagonist, and others. Among these sub-segments, NOACs is expected to account for the largest revenue share as well as is anticipated to exhibit the fastest growth among all the sub-segments over the forecast timeframe. This growth is attributed towards the increasing adoption of NOACs emerging nations and growing usage of NOACs instead of the warfarin. There are various NOAC drugs present in the market namely betrixaban, edoxaban, rivaroxaban, dabigatran, and apixaban. These drugs come with lot of benefits like quick in action, minimum contact with food and drugs, among others, which in turn are influencing the growth of this market.

By distribution channel, the hospital pharmacy segment holds the highest market share 50% in 2023. As the usage of anticoagulants is risky and it all often needs prescription after a thorough diagnosis the hospital pharmacy is happen to be the best locations for the sales. As per the current trends of the anticoagulants market the retail pharmacy segment is also expected to hold the second largest share. Retail pharmacies are able to provide efficient facilities in case of refilling prescriptions. Apart from the retail segment the online pharmacy segment is also expected to have the highest during the forecast period as there is an increasing usage of online pharmacy facilities by various nations. Online pharmacies are gaining popularity due to the ease and convenience it provides.
